Is pgadminIII using local domain sockets or TCP/IP sockets? Out of the
box pgsql usually just answers local domain sockets, and I don't have a
clue what windows supports in that way, etc... Since local domain
sockets only work for processes on the same machine, this means that,
after initial install, postgresql is not visible on anything other than
the box it's installed on.
You'll need to edit pg_hba.conf to give other machines permission to
authenticate, as well as postgresql.conf to accept tcpip connections,
then restart the server.
